Viagra Ingredient Sildenafil May Slow Cancer Metastasis

Research published in Cancer Research suggests sildenafil, the active ingredient in Viagra, may block cancer cells from accessing cholesterol needed to spread to other organs.

2

A study of five million medical records, including 40,000 cancer patients, found that men who used sildenafil had better overall survival rates than those who did not.

3

Experts emphasize that these findings are early-stage and do not constitute a cancer treatment, advising patients against using the drug for this purpose without medical consultation.
